In the list of offered magical services, there is often a proposal to remove the celibacy crown, which prevents a person from meeting his soul mate and starting a family.

Listen to some magicians and witches working with clients, this is how 99 percent of single people wear this crown. It is clear, of course, that someone needs to make money, but is the crown of celibacy so often found and is he not a myth himself?

In most cases, the specialists offering services are disingenuous, calling all cases when a person fails to meet a partner and get married (marry) despite the fact that he really wants it to be the crown of celibacy. In the end, what difference does it make to him from what they will "treat" him, if in the end they promise that they will be cured. And the "crown of celibacy" sounds so beautiful and mysterious! And, most importantly, it is frightening, because something final and hopeless emanates from this concept. Let's try to deal with this phenomenon.

There are two news. As usual, good and bad. Bad: the crown of celibacy exists. Good: it is quite rare. What is meant by the crown of celibacy? Perhaps, at first, about what is not.

The crown of celibacy does not affect a person from the inside, it is an external formation alien to him, created by someone from the outside, and not by the person himself. A crown is a structure that a person can wear. And what is worn protects from outside influences. The celibacy wreath is most often made by order of "well-wishers". It is inappropriate to create a celibacy wreath just like that, walking around like throwing a curse. Therefore, cases of putting a celibacy crown on a person are much less common than damage, the evil eye, or the inner destructive work of the person himself.

This structure is called the crown for a reason. This is a closed formation, often with fairly clear contours. The crown is put on the person from above, enclosing him in his arms, but not tightly squeezing. Subjectively, the crown is not felt, it does not press, does not interfere with the normal course of everyday life.

Inside the crown, a person does not feel the constraint of movement, he continues his usual energy exchange with the environment. For clarity, it is worth noting that the crown may look like a large crown, turned upside down with the teeth and put on a person so that the teeth enter the ground. A person continues to live without suspecting what is inside such a crown.

Naturally, you cannot get close to such a person. The maximum is to stand side by side on opposite sides of the crown. Therefore, if a person himself is by nature active, some kind of love relationship can be established, but people will not be able to get close. This leads to a series of romances that end in parting, and even with the most wonderful relationships, people do not reach the stage of living together or getting married.

Very often, an active strong person does not even think about the fact that not everything is in order. If a person is passive by nature, he may not have any close relationships with persons of the opposite sex at all from the moment the celibacy crown was put on. But he is more likely to think about the reason for this state of affairs than someone who does not greatly interfere with the crown from being the object of attention of the opposite sex.

The crown of celibacy is rarely visible, it looks like an invisible electric fence, beyond which it is impossible to get out. It keeps a person in the piece of the world allotted to him, not allowing him to intersect with the world of other people.

To effectively remove the crown, you need to manipulate it, the opposite of putting it on, that is, lifting it from below, remove it over your head. After removing the crown, a person's life changes.

He becomes the object of attention of the opposite sex, sometimes tripled attention. There is a feeling that all those people are beginning to show interest in a person, which could have shown him during the years that he had a crown, but earlier because of him they could not. If nothing has changed significantly in a person's life, it is unlikely that the crown was the cause of failures on the love front.
